What Are the Key Steps to Successfully Digitize Your Business?
Digitalization is part of a structured approach that alternates analysis, planning, implementation, and team support. The first mandatory stop: the digital diagnosis. This foundational step measures the company’s maturity regarding digital, examines the digital tools already in place, security, organization, and available skills. At this stage, it is about revealing concrete needs to build a tailored project.
After this starting point, a clear digital roadmap must be established. This involves defining precise objectives, choosing useful KPIs, planning steps, and prioritizing. This roadmap guides the choice of solutions: ERP, CRM, cloud computing, tools for artificial intelligence or data analysis. The entire technical setup always relies on a solid cybersecurity policy.
The human factor remains crucial. For digitalization to bear fruit, the company must invest in skills development. Continuous training ensures that everyone appropriates the new tools. The support of experts and the designation of digital ambassadors facilitate engagement and the adoption of best practices. Taking the time to explore public aid mechanisms, such as digital vouchers or local financing, can also accelerate transformation and reduce project costs.
Finally, an appropriate governance structure is essential: transparent management, involvement of all stakeholders, and regular monitoring of progress. This approach encourages agility and continuous adjustments, making the transformation robust and sustainable.
Expert Support: The Real Difference to Take Action and Train Your Teams
Digital transformation only comes to life with structured support that can mobilize all employees around a common goal. This support is based on two pillars: a strategic vision and on-the-ground involvement. Managers, supported by specialists, translate strategy into concrete achievements rooted in the company’s reality.
Change management plays a key role. Training, coaching, and supporting each employee in adopting new digital tools: this approach, sometimes underestimated, determines the speed of appropriation and collective success. Expert support offers tailored solutions based on the size, sector, and specificities of each organization. Digital ambassadors energize the dissemination of skills and contribute to establishing a common digital culture.
Among the available initiatives are France NUM, OCAPIAT, CMA, and Bpifrance, which offer diagnostics, personalized training, advice, and financial support. Continuous training remains central to strengthening skills, while mastering digital marketing tools, from SEO to social media, opens new growth avenues.
